UPM plans to increase its growth focus through streamlined business portfolio (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 16, 2025)
UPM is a material solutions company with world-class businesses in growth markets. With the intended graphic paper Joint Venture between UPM and Sappi announced today, UPM aims to position the communication paper business for continued value creation for its customers in a way that benefits UPM shareholders. Assuming the Joint Venture is formed, UPM would achieve a stronger growth profile, improved margins and leverage, with no direct sales exposure to the declining European and North American graphic paper markets.

Packaging Corporation of America to shut down machines in Washington, affecting 200 jobs (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 16, 2025)
Packaging Corporation of America announced that it will permanently shut down the No. 2 paper machine (W2) and kraft pulping facilities at its Wallula, WA containerboard mill. PCA will continue to operate the No. 3 paper machine (W3) and recycled pulping facilities at the mill.

Boise Cascade Announces CEO Transition: Nate Jorgensen to retire, Jeff Strom appointed successor (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 16, 2025)
Boise Cascade Company announced that Nate Jorgensen, Chief Executive Officer, plans to retire effective March 2, 2026. The board of directors has unanimously appointed Jeff Strom, Chief Operating Officer, to succeed Jorgensen effective March 3, 2026. Jorgensen will continue to serve as a director on the Company's board after his retirement. The Company does not plan to backfill the chief operating officer role after the transition.

ProAmpac to Acquire TC Transcontinental Packaging from TC Transcontinental (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 16, 2025)
ProAmpac, a global innovator in flexible packaging and material science, announced that it has signed a definitive agreement to acquire TC Transcontinental Packaging ("TCP") from TC Transcontinental for US$1.51 billion (approximately CAD$2.1 billion), subject to customary adjustments for debt and debt-like items, cash, and net working capital.

CEO of Lenzing AG Rohit Aggarwal resigns due to personal reasons, effective 31 January 2026 (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 16, 2025)
CEO of Lenzing AG Rohit Aggarwal resigns due to personal reasons, effective 31 January 2026. Following Mr. Aggarwal's departure, Lenzing AG will be led by a three-member Managing Board. The process to appoint a new Chief Executive Officer has been initiated by the Supervisory Board and an appointment will be announced at the appropriate time.

Voith to cut up to 2,500 jobs (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 16, 2025)
German machine manufacturer Voith said it plans to cut up to 2,500 jobs, representing about 10% of its workforce, as part of a strategic review of its organizational structure and staffing levels.

Rayonier Advanced Materials President and CEO De Lyle W. Bloomquist announces intention to retire (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 16, 2025)
Rayonier Advanced Materials Inc., a global leader of cellulose-based technologies, announced that President and Chief Executive Officer De Lyle W. Bloomquist has informed the Board of Directors of his intention to retire by the time of the Company's 2026 Annual Meeting of Stockholders, expected in May 2026. Mr. Bloomquist also confirmed he will not stand for re-election to the Company's Board of Directors. To ensure continuity and a smooth transition, Bloomquist will remain in his role as CEO until a successor is appointed.

Mayr Melnhof Karton: MM Kwidzyn Accelerates Path towards CO2 Neutrality with Continuous Digester Investment (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 2, 2025)
MM Kwidzyn is taking a decisive step towards a more sustainable future with the installation of a state-of-the-art continuous digester in its integrated pulp mill, complemented by additional energy improvement measures focusing on the reutilization of residual heat and reducing overall energy consumption.

Boise Cascade reaches agreement to purchase Holden Humphrey (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 2, 2025)
Boise Cascade has reached an agreement to purchase Humphrey Company, Inc., a two-step distributor of building materials located in Chicopee, Massachusetts, with $145 million in revenue over the last 12 months, according to Boise Cascade.

Stora Enso To Revamp Financial Reporting Structure In 2026 (relevance: 11.1%, date: Dec 2, 2025)
Under the new setup, Stora Enso will reorganize its businesses into four segments: Consumer Packaging, Integrated Packaging, Biomaterials, and Other, which replaces its current six-segment model.
